Siem Pilot Successfully Rescues 510 Refugees from Mediterranean

Apr 16, 2017 23:04

On April 16, 2017, the 'Siem Pilot' undertook a remarkable humanitarian mission, successfully rescuing 510 refugees from the perilous waters of the Mediterranean Sea. This operation was part of Frontex's ongoing initiative, dubbed Triton, aimed at providing life-saving support to those in distress. Following this significant rescue, the vessel was reportedly on course to assist even more individuals in need. Siem Pilot Safeguards 503 Lives in Mediterranean Rescue Mission

Mar 06, 2017 11:17

On March 5, 2017, the 'Siem Pilot' docked in Catania, bringing with it a staggering 503 migrants who had been rescued from perilous conditions in the Mediterranean Sea. These individuals had embarked on a treacherous journey, fleeing from Libya just a week earlier aboard overcrowded rubber boats and small vessels. The 'Siem Pilot' has participated in a total of eight rescue operations since March 2, demonstrating its commitment and capacity to aid those in desperate need. Among the rescued passengers were 358 men, 29 women, and 116 children, including infants. Many of the migrants arrived with various injuries, including bullet wounds, burns, and head trauma, highlighting the dangerous circumstances they faced. Tragically, a 16-year-old boy suffering from a chronic disease passed away shortly after boarding the vessel. The dedicated crew provided him with the best possible care to ensure his final moments were devoid of pain. It's worth noting that this young boy had made the perilous journey alone. In connection with the rescue, two individuals suspected of involvement in human trafficking were apprehended and subsequently handed over to Italian authorities for further investigation. This incident underscores the ongoing humanitarian crisis in the Mediterranean and the vital role played by vessels like the 'Siem Pilot' in saving lives.

Tragedy at Sea: 29 Rescued, 12 Found Dead, and Approximately 100 Missing Near Libya

Nov 03, 2016 10:57

In a harrowing incident on November 2, the rescue ship 'Siem Pilot' braved two-meter waves to search for nearly 100 individuals missing after a tragic capsizing of an inflatable boat off the northern coast of Libya. The ill-fated rubber dinghy, carrying between 120 and 140 people, overturned, prompting a swift rescue operation. Sadly, the disaster claimed the lives of 12 individuals, including three young children. The courageous crew of the 'Siem Pilot' successfully rescued 29 survivors who are now en route to meet with an Italian Coastguard vessel. This Italian ship will assume responsibility for the deceased and those they saved. Meanwhile, other vessels remain engaged in ongoing rescue efforts in the perilous waters.
